Derek Wilson walked away from a 6-figure salary, sold his dream home and started over with his young family in rugged central Idaho to save the family ranch after his father's death. Building his new life revealed the simple but effective shifts in mindset that anyone can access to create a life they love in ANY circumstance. Derek's podcast and interviews help countless others reframe their perspective about what happiness and success look like in 3 key areas: Liberation (recognizing and breaking free from a lack of fulfillment), Lifestyle (living with intent instead of by default), and Legacy (building change that lasts).
